Bytown Bluegrass provides entertainment for a wide variety of events, including outdoor festivals and fairs, indoor concerts, conferences, jamborees, gospel shows, and private parties. The group is equally at home in an 80-seat auditorium or on a festival stage in front of thousands of fans.
